Zero-Compromise Quality, Every Phase

How Your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er Guarantees Zero-Defect Delivery

Our proprietary 5-step QC process embeds quality checks at every production stage — not just the end — so every hoodie that leaves our facility meets your exact standard.

Phase 1

Materials Quality Testing

Every fabric batch is tested for weight, color fastness, and shrinkage before cutting begins, ensuring your boxy hoodie is built on a flawless foundation.

Phase 2

Cutting Precision Inspection

Pattern accuracy and layer-by-layer cut consistency are verified by our QC team, eliminating size deviations and fabric waste before sewing starts.

Phase 3

Craft & Construction Audit

Seam allowances, print placement, embroidery registration, and hardware positioning are checked mid-production, catching errors while correction is still fast and cost-free.

Phase 4

Sewing Line Quality Control

Stitch density, thread tension, and seam integrity are tested at timed intervals on the production floor, keeping real-time defect rates at near zero.

Phase 5

Finished Garment Final Inspection

Every completed hoodie receives a full visual and dimensional audit before packing — only pieces that pass all five checkpoints are approved for shipment.

1. What Is a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er?

A boxy fit hoodie is defined by three pattern engineering choices: shoulder seams dropped 2–4 inches past the natural shoulder point, a torso width 4–6 inches wider than a slim-fit equivalent, and a body length 2–3 inches shorter than a standard pullover. These adjustments are not cosmetic tweaks — they require entirely different pattern blocks, fabric tension calculations, and sewing sequences than a conventional hoodie.

A boxy fit hoodie manufacturer differs from a generic cut-and-sew factory in that it maintains dedicated pattern libraries for oversized silhouettes, employs operators trained on dropped-shoulder alignment, and calibrates its flatlock or coverstitch machines specifically for the wider seam paths this silhouette demands. Standard factories that occasionally attempt the style frequently produce inconsistent shoulder drops and puckered side seams because their block patterns and machine settings are optimized for fitted garments.

For streetwear and trendy brands, this distinction is commercially critical. A 0.5-inch inconsistency in shoulder drop across a production run of 500 units creates visible size irregularities that erode brand credibility — particularly for direct-to-consumer labels where customers post side-by-side comparisons online.

Choosing a dedicated boxy fit hoodie manufacturer means sourcing from a partner whose entire production infrastructure — from grading rules to QC checkpoints — is calibrated to this silhouette. 2. Evolution of the Boxy Hoodie and Its Manufacturers

By the mid-1980s, oversized hoodies had become a visual signature of New York hip-hop and California skate crews, valued precisely because standard slim-cut patterns were dropped at the shoulders and cropped at the hem to exaggerate the block silhouette. Early adopters cut and resewed fitted blanks themselves, signaling to garment factories that a new pattern geometry was needed well before brands formalized orders for it.

Around 2012–2015, labels such as Supreme, FEAR OF GOD, and Vetements pushed the boxy drop-shoulder silhouette into global streetwear consciousness, driving order volumes that forced manufacturers to retire the narrow sleeve-pitch templates used for fitted knitwear and invest in wider armhole jigs, extended cutting tables, and pattern blocks carrying up to 30–40 cm of extra chest circumference. A boxy fit hoodie manufacturer had to re-grade every size run from scratch because standard size increments built for tapered fits produced misshapen results on a true boxy frame.

The production divergence between boxy and slim knitwear became structural after 2018. Heavier fabrications — typically 380–500 GSM French terry or heavyweight fleece — demanded separate sewing lines with industrial machines capable of handling dense seam stacks, while fabric-cutting yield loss on wide-body patterns required dedicated nesting software unavailable in most slim-knitwear facilities. Specialized boxy fit hoodie manufacturers consequently built distinct supplier networks for ring-spun cotton fleece, separate from the open-end yarn mills that had long supplied the fitted basics market.

4. Materials and Fabrics Every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er Should Offer

Fabric choice defines hand-feel, drape, and durability — the factors separating a premium boxy silhouette from a budget one. A credible boxy fit hoodie manufacturer should stock at least five core fabric families to cover seasonal needs and price tiers.

Fabric TypeGSM RangeBest Use CaseRelative Cost
100% Cotton Fleece280–380gSpring/fall breathable dropsMedium
Cotton-Poly Blend280–340gYear-round, shrink-resistantLow–Medium
French Terry240–300gLightweight, moisture-wickingMedium
Waffle Knit200–260gWarm-season, textural designsLow–Medium
Heavyweight Fleece380–500gPremium winter/statement dropsHigh

Cotton and Cotton-Poly Blend Fleece

custom hoodie streetwear oversized hoodie pullover sweatshirt — street-hoodie-26

Ring-spun 100% cotton fleece (280–380g GSM) delivers superior softness and breathability, making it the default choice for spring and fall drops. Cotton-polyester blends (50/50 or 60/40) at 280–340g GSM cut shrinkage risk by 40–60% versus pure cotton and reduce fabric cost by 10–15%.

French Terry and Waffle Knit

custom hoodie streetwear oversized hoodie pullover sweatshirt — street-hoodie-27

French terry (240–300g GSM) features a looped interior that wicks moisture, making it ideal for year-round lightweight hoodies. Waffle knit construction (200–260g GSM) adds surface texture and suits warm-season drops where breathability outranks bulk.

Heavyweight Options and Sustainability Certifications

Premium heavyweight fleece at 380–500g GSM commands a 20–35% fabric cost premium but communicates quality to streetwear consumers. Request GOTS certification for organic cotton or OEKO-TEX Standard 100 for chemical-safety compliance — both are increasingly required by European and North American retailers.

6. Key Construction Quality Elements to Inspect

When reviewing samples from any boxy fit hoodie manufacturer, structural details separate lasting garments from fast-fashion rejects. Five construction checkpoints reveal whether a factory truly understands drop-shoulder streetwear construction.

Drop-Shoulder Seam Placement and Fit

The shoulder seam should fall 2–4 inches past the natural shoulder point on a size-medium sample before bulk approval. A seam sitting at the natural shoulder creates a standard silhouette, directly undermining the boxy aesthetic the style demands.

Two-Panel vs. Three-Panel Hood Construction

custom hoodie streetwear oversized hoodie pullover sweatshirt — street-hoodie-31

Two-panel hoods use a single center seam and lie flatter against the back; three-panel hoods add a gusset for more volume and structured drape. For oversized streetwear, three-panel construction aligns better with current silhouette expectations.

Rib Cuff and Waistband Weight

custom hoodie streetwear oversized hoodie pullover sweatshirt — street-hoodie-32

Cuffs and waistbands should use 1×1 or 2×2 rib knit at 280–320 GSM. Lightweight rib below 250 GSM loses recovery after 10–15 wash cycles, causing flaring and a permanently worn-out appearance.

Kangaroo Pocket Stitching and Depth

custom hoodie streetwear oversized hoodie pullover sweatshirt — street-hoodie-33

A properly constructed kangaroo pocket uses bar-tacking at both upper corners with reinforced double stitching to prevent tearing under load. Pocket depth should reach at least 7 inches to accommodate a standard smartphone.

Stitch Density and Fabric Finish

Industry-standard SPI for fleece hoodies is 7–9 on main seams; below 6 SPI risks seam splitting under repeated stress. Request pre-shrunk fabric for dimensional stability, or specify garment-wash finish when a vintage, broken-in texture is the target aesthetic.

7. How to Choose the Right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er

Selecting the right boxy fit hoodie manufacturer requires more than comparing price sheets. A structured evaluation across certifications, sampling speed, tech-pack capability, and communication separates reliable specialists from generalist CMT factories.

Certifications and Audit Options

Prioritize factories holding OEKO-TEX Standard 100, BSCI, or WRAP certification — these audits verify chemical safety, labor conditions, and production standards. For higher-stakes orders, commission a third-party inspection through agencies like QIMA or Bureau Veritas before placing a bulk PO.

Sampling Speed and MOQ Flexibility

Specialist streetwear manufacturers typically deliver pre-production samples within 7–14 days; generalist CMT factories often quote 21–30 days for unfamiliar oversized silhouettes. MOQ tiers of 50–100 units per colorway signal startup-friendly flexibility, and bulk lead times should not exceed 30–45 days for orders under 1,000 units.

Tech-Pack Capability

A qualified boxy fit hoodie manufacturer reads and executes a full tech pack — graded size specs, construction callouts, Pantone color references, and trim BOM. Factories that ask you to ‘just send a sample’ lack the technical infrastructure for consistent repeat production.

References from Streetwear Brands

Request references from streetwear or retail clients specifically, not generic apparel accounts. A specialist who has produced for comparable labels understands drop-shoulder angles, oversized proportioning, and ribbed kangaroo pockets without extensive fit-correction rounds.

Communication and IP Protection

Require a signed NDA before sharing logo files, pattern artwork, or proprietary design elements. Dedicated account managers — rather than rotating sales staff — reduce miscommunication on repeat runs and should respond within 24 hours across time zones.

8. Common Mistakes Buyers Make When Sourcing a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er

Even experienced buyers lose money sourcing a boxy fit hoodie manufacturer by overlooking technical details that compound into rework costs. The six errors below account for the majority of production disputes and delayed launch windows.

Skipping Fit Sample Iterations

A proto sample rarely captures the dropped-shoulder angle a true boxy silhouette demands. Budget at least two fit iterations before approving a size set — one correction round adds 10–14 days but prevents costly mass-production recuts.

Underspecifying GSM in the Purchase Order

Listing ‘heavyweight fleece’ without a GSM figure lets a factory substitute lighter cloth and still claim compliance. Lock a specific range — 320–420 gsm for boxy styles — plus a ±10 gsm tolerance in the PO, and confirm on the bulk roll.

Ignoring Shrinkage Testing

Cotton-rich fleece can shrink 3–8% after the first wash if not pre-shrunk. Require a wash-shrinkage report per AATCC 135 before bulk sign-off; reject any fabric exceeding 3% shrinkage in either dimension.

Choosing Price Over Pattern Expertise

A boxy fit hoodie manufacturer quoting 15–20% below market often lacks graded pattern files for a wide-body block. Verify the factory owns its patterns outright — not just the ability to copy a sample — since pattern ownership directly drives reorder consistency.

Conflating Trading Companies with Direct Manufacturers

Trading companies add a 15–30% markup and insert a communication layer that distorts tech-pack details. Request a factory business license and a live video call from the production floor before committing to any order.

Failing to Lock In Colourway Tolerances

Colour drifts of ΔE 2.0 or more are visible to the naked eye yet go unspecified in most purchase orders. Submit a Pantone TCX reference and require a signed dye-lot approval with a ΔE ≤1.5 limit before bulk dyeing begins.

9. Step-by-Step Guide to Launching Your Brand with a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er

A structured five-step launch sequence prevents costly rework and missed drop dates. Each stage below splits responsibilities between buyer and boxy fit hoodie manufacturer so nothing falls through the gaps.

Finalize Tech Pack and Silhouette Brief

Buyer delivers Pantone color codes, a graded measurements table, target fabric GSM (typically 280–380 gsm for fleece), and reference sketches or garments.

Manufacturer handles pattern drafting, block creation, and bill of materials. Incomplete specs add 1–2 weeks of back-and-forth before sampling even begins.

Request and Evaluate Proto Sample

Proto samples arrive in 7–14 days and typically cost $50–$150 each. Buyer evaluates silhouette accuracy, drop-shoulder width, seam placement, and fabric hand-feel against the brief.

Manufacturer matches spec-sheet construction details including stitch type (flatlock or chainstitch), hem width, and pocket placement.

Approve Fit Sample and Decoration Strike-Off

Fit samples incorporate all proto corrections; decoration strike-offs confirm screen print, embroidery, or DTF color accuracy against approved Pantone references.

Buyer signs off in writing on both. Manufacturer seals a strike-off swatch held as the binding bulk production standard.

Place Bulk Order with QC Milestones

Bulk orders typically require a 30–50% deposit at placement. Buyer sets written QC checkpoint dates tied to the manufacturer’s five production stages: materials, cutting, craft, sewing, and finished goods.

Manufacturer supplies inline inspection reports at each milestone before advancing to the next stage.

Arrange Pre-Shipment Inspection and Logistics

Buyer books a third-party inspector (SGS or Bureau Veritas) or formally requests the manufacturer’s finished-goods QC report before balance payment.

Manufacturer prepares export documentation, commercial invoice, and packing list. Bulk-to-shipment lead times typically run 25–45 days depending on order volume and decoration complexity.

10. Pricing and Cost Tiers When Working with a Boxy Fit Hoodie Manufacturer

Unit price at a China-based boxy fit hoodie manufacturer typically ranges from $6 to $28 per piece, driven by three variables: order quantity tier, fabric weight (280–420 GSM ring-spun cotton fleece or French terry), and decoration complexity. Hitting the 500-piece threshold usually unlocks a meaningful price break.

Decoration adds cost at two layers: a one-time setup or digitizing fee, and a per-unit add-on for each garment. Screen printing, embroidery, DTG, and all-over print (AOP) carry very different cost profiles — suppliers often waive setup fees at higher quantities, so this is a realistic negotiation point.

  • Screen print: $50–$150 setup per color; $0.50–$2.00 per-unit add-on
  • DTG: no setup fee; $3–$8 per-unit; suits photographic or multi-color designs
  • Embroidery: $50–$200 digitizing fee; $2–$6 per-unit; premium texture for chest logos
  • Heat transfer/vinyl: $30–$100 setup; $1–$4 per-unit; fast turnaround for small runs
  • AOP/sublimation: $100–$300 setup; $4–$10 per-unit; requires poly-blend base fabric
Order Quantity TierEst. Unit Price (USD)Sample Lead TimeBulk Lead Time
50–100 pcs$18–$287–10 days25–35 days
101–300 pcs$14–$207–10 days20–30 days
301–500 pcs$10–$165–7 days18–25 days
501–1,000 pcs$8–$135–7 days15–20 days
1,001+ pcs$6–$105–7 days12–18 days
